Tuslaw High School Hires Broc Dial, Former Coach of the Year, to Lead Football Program

TUSCARAWAS TWP. — Tuslaw High School is turning to a coach with quite a recent pedigree to turn things around for the Mustangs football program.

Pending school board approval, Tuslaw is hiring Broc Dial — a Northeast Inland District Coach of the Year two of the last three seasons at Dalton — to lead its football program. The board meets Monday. He would replace Matt Gulling, who went 6-24 in three seasons as Tuslaw’s head coach.

“Coach Dial’s ability to instill a winning culture and philosophy matches with the goals of Tuslaw Athletics,” the school district wrote in a press release Tuesday.

According to the Tuslaw news release, Dial also will be hired as a teacher in the district.

The Tuslaw football team has not had a winning season since 2018 and the Mustangs have really struggled within their own league. They are 1-25 in the PAC-7 since 2020.

In nearby Dalton, things were much different under Dial. In seven seasons at Dalton — split over two stretches, 2016-17 and 2019-23 — his teams went 68-18 and won five Wayne County Athletic League titles. His teams made the state playoffs all seven seasons.

Dial resigned as Dalton’s head coach Jan. 11a little over a month after guiding the Bulldogs on a memorable run to the OHSAA Division VII state finals. Ohio small-school powerhouse Marion Local beat Dalton 38-0 in the title game in Canton.

Dial owned a 12-4 playoff record over the last four seasons and was 14-7 overall in the postseason.

Dial is a 2004 graduate of Northwest High School, where he was an All-Ohio offensive lineman. He helped Northwest to a 10-0 regular season his senior year. He also coached Dalton to a 10-0 regular season in 2017.

He earned a teacher’s degree from Baldwin Wallace in History and master’s degree from Concordia University in School Leadership.

The 2023 Mustangs went 2-8, losing their final seven games of the season, all league games. They have not won more than one league game in a season since going 2-5 in the PAC-7 in 2019. Since 2019, the Mustangs are 11-37 overall.

Their last winning season came in 2018, when they finished 6-5 after a first-round playoff loss to Orrville, a league rival. Tuslaw went 4-3 in PAC-7 play that year.
